CMDB Systems: Some Key (and Surprising) Findings from Deployments
May 01, 2015

Dennis Drogseth
EMA

Share this

In writing CMDB Systems: Making Change Work in the Age of Cloud and Agile, we gained a lot by talking to deployments. In the spirit of our own recommendations for how to manage and optimize a CMDB-related initiative, our goal was to learn from reality more than just preach a series of best practices. What I’ve chosen to write about here are just a few highlights, following four key areas of interest:

■ Dialog, Communication and Stakeholder Planning

■ Architecture

■ Cloud

■ Agile

Start with: CMDB Systems in the Age of Cloud and Agile - Why We Wrote the Book

Dialog, Communication and Stakeholder Planning

Taking the time to engage stakeholders effectively is one of the bigger challenges in any strategic IT initiative, and one of the biggest single catalysts for CMDB success. One of the problems, of course, is time and energy to engage in something new, no matter how valuable, when most IT professionals are already overworked and trapped within their own treadmills.

The Hamster Scenario
“Cultural challenges were a big factor — in getting the silos to think about new ways of working together. Something like what I call the “Hamster Scenario” running around its wheel. You’ve got some processes in place and you’re used to those processes. When do you step back and change those processes? In other words when does the hamster get off its wheel and think it might move in other directions?” (a transportation/travel company from Chapter Eight)

Next is a comment in both the challenge and resolution category about dealing with a very different concern — too much enthusiasm, and with it, too many expectations:

Challenge/resolution: Trying to please everyone
“When we discussed the CMDB with different groups in our organization, each team got very excited about what they wanted to get out of our CMDB. But very quickly we could see that many of their priorities were at least a couple of years away from implementation. So everybody’s understanding of the scope was different. For instance, we had desktop people saying 'can I inventory my mouse? Can I inventory my keyboard and my monitor?' They all wanted to see those as CIs.

“But managing this wasn’t too difficult. I asked everyone two questions; first, ‘What is this equipment that you’re prepared to manage from day one through its entire lifecycle as a CI?’ And second, ‘Do you have the resources to manage these items as CIs once they get into our CMDB?’ If there were no costs associated with CI inclusion, then everyone would want everything included in the CMDB right at the start. But as soon as they begin to understand the costs, including update and data access costs, they viewed it differently.” (a manufacturer from Chapter Four)

Architecture

We spend a lot of time in the book looking at architectural challenges, including a very progressive technology landscape as it’s evolving to support more dynamic and complex service interdependencies. Below are just two perspectives, the first on service modeling, and the second on assimilating multiple data sets.

Service models vs. data models
“Our Service Model is based on ITIL’s definition, and it’s all about the processes, functions, services and technologies that we deliver to our customers. So therefore it’s a separate idea that can be applied to the data model. Our Global Finance team defines our business strategies company-wide. And these are of course not about a data model or technology. But that’s where we started, so we can trace everything we do back to those business services.” (manufacturer from Chapter Four)

Assimilating and reconciling many multiple sources
“Each discovery tool has its own idiosyncracies in terms of what it captures and how it works. This impacts both our ability to manage it and our ability to optimize our hardware and software asset investments in terms of utilization and licensing. With our integrated data analytics, we’re leveraging 35 different discovery tools in order to get a more cohesive 'golden record' for the CMS ... This includes desktop security, network management and administration, application dependency mapping, systems management and administration, asset management solutions, and BSM performance management, just to mention a few categories.” (a financial services company Chapter Nine)

Cloud and Agile

Since our book does its best to focus on the very current landscape of cloud and agile, I thought it fitting to end with two excerpts — one on each point. I think both are a bit surprising as well as insightful, but I’ll let you decide which might raise more eyebrows.

Cloud
“... the general idea is to leverage ADDM visibility for consistency across the cloud and hybrid cloud environments — so that you can identify servers that are not registered in your configuration management tools. Another example of the value of this type of visibility is keeping track of the Amazon Machine Images (AMIs), which can potentially lead to malware and other problems. There are over 30,000 community AMIs and not all of them are patched correctly, so if a developer decides to use one that’s not authorized it may cause problems. When that happens, ADDM can help to identify and remediate the problem.” (a software manufacturer from Chapter Fifteen)

Agile/ DevOps
“Before investing in the CMDB we were very fragmented in how we saved information. Some of it was in Visio, for instance. Some were in OneNote or in Excel. We also had a lot of Word documents — so it was difficult-to-impossible to get insight into impacts when we were about to make a change …

“At that time, development was a little bit ahead of operations in terms of maturity. Our operations organization was fairly siloed and hadn’t yet invested in best practices. We often had no clear idea what would happen if, for instance, we unplugged a server. Most of our change records there resided inside someone’s head … If somebody was sick at the wrong time, it could be very disruptive …

“But we did have some [scrum] best practices that had evolved in development for source control. So when we saw what a CMDB could do, we felt we had a chance to transform our way of working when it came to managing change.” (a mid-tier financial planning company from Chapter Fifteen)

All right, I’ll be candid. Probably the biggest single “revelation from the trenches” for me was this last — a development team purchasing a CMDB to support an agile environment using scrum and pushing it into operations.

The point being in these and other insights is that each deployment shares common challenges with other deployments, on the one hand; but is also distinctive on the other hand. The goal is, invariably, to find the best path for you — while learning from the many other voices of wisdom and experience available. And this was, perhaps, the single most pervasive "guiding light" in seeking out optimal content for our book.

Dennis Drogseth is VP at Enterprise Management Associates (EMA)
Share this

The Latest

November 20, 2024

New research from ServiceNow and ThoughtLab reveals that less than 30% of banks feel their transformation efforts are meeting evolving customer digital needs. Additionally, 52% say they must revamp their strategy to counter competition from outside the sector. Adapting to these challenges isn't just about staying competitive — it's about staying in business ...

November 19, 2024

Leaders in the financial services sector are bullish on AI, with 95% of business and IT decision makers saying that AI is a top C-Suite priority, and 96% of respondents believing it provides their business a competitive advantage, according to Riverbed's Global AI and Digital Experience Survey ...

November 18, 2024

SLOs have long been a staple for DevOps teams to monitor the health of their applications and infrastructure ... Now, as digital trends have shifted, more and more teams are looking to adapt this model for the mobile environment. This, however, is not without its challenges ...

November 14, 2024

Modernizing IT infrastructure has become essential for organizations striving to remain competitive. This modernization extends beyond merely upgrading hardware or software; it involves strategically leveraging new technologies like AI and cloud computing to enhance operational efficiency, increase data accessibility, and improve the end-user experience ...

November 13, 2024

AI sure grew fast in popularity, but are AI apps any good? ... If companies are going to keep integrating AI applications into their tech stack at the rate they are, then they need to be aware of AI's limitations. More importantly, they need to evolve their testing regiment ...

November 12, 2024

If you were lucky, you found out about the massive CrowdStrike/Microsoft outage last July by reading about it over coffee. Those less fortunate were awoken hours earlier by frantic calls from work ... Whether you were directly affected or not, there's an important lesson: all organizations should be conducting in-depth reviews of testing and change management ...

November 08, 2024

In MEAN TIME TO INSIGHT Episode 11, Shamus McGillicuddy, VP of Research, Network Infrastructure and Operations, at EMA discusses Secure Access Service Edge (SASE) ...

November 07, 2024

On average, only 48% of digital initiatives enterprise-wide meet or exceed their business outcome targets according to Gartner's annual global survey of CIOs and technology executives ...

November 06, 2024

Artificial intelligence (AI) is rapidly reshaping industries around the world. From optimizing business processes to unlocking new levels of innovation, AI is a critical driver of success for modern enterprises. As a result, business leaders — from DevOps engineers to CTOs — are under pressure to incorporate AI into their workflows to stay competitive. But the question isn't whether AI should be adopted — it's how ...

November 05, 2024

The mobile app industry continues to grow in size, complexity, and competition. Also not slowing down? Consumer expectations are rising exponentially along with the use of mobile apps. To meet these expectations, mobile teams need to take a comprehensive, holistic approach to their app experience ...